There are usually two heating elements within the storage tank, one located near the bottom and the other one within the middle of the tank. A thermostat that controls and monitors the temperature of the water inside the tank delivers energy to heating elements when it detects that the temperature of the water is below the temperature that is set by the thermostat. An electric tank type water heater makes use of the power supply cable 220V to supply electric power to the thermostat.

In short conventional water heaters are less expensive up front than tanks that are tankless, and repairs are generally more affordable. They're not as long-lasting as tankless heaters, and you'll have to pay more each month to heat your water. Tankless models, on the other hand, are more expensive to purchase, but will cost less to operate since the hot water heater is heated as needed. Tankless water heaters have a life expectancy of over 20 years as compared to 10-15 years of a storage tank heater. The heart of both gas and electric water heaters heat water exactly the same way. Trip tubes are a pipe that allows cold water to flow into the tank. The water that is cold runs down into the tank before being heated. How the tank heats water is dependent on the kind; in gas heated water heaters, a gas burner is located in the tank. The burner gets heated up and releases hot toxic air. In gas heated machines there is an air vent located within the tank, which deposits this toxic air outside to the surroundings. When it is released it is heated by gas that passes through the chimney, which heats the cold water around it as a result. The hot water gets kept in the tank for future use, anytime you turn on the hot water faucet and new cold water flows through the drip pipe and into the tank. This cold water replaces warmer water and leaves the heat pipe to be used in your fixtures and appliances.

To ensure that you don't go without hot water in your home There are some indicators to be looking for to know that your water heater is on its last legs. The age of your water heater is an important aspect to consider. If the water heater you have is older than 10 years old, you'll be able to spot a problem. A malfunctioning water heater can also cause strange banging or clunking sounds when it is heating up. This is caused by an accumulation of sediment inside the water heater. The sediment damages your water heater and may cause it to stop working. Leakage of water from your heater may be a sign of a problem. Heating accounts for the largest portion of the utility bill, why not choose a model that is energy efficient? The standard water heaters are always in operation, whether you're using hot water or not. Tankless water heaters will allow you to use hot water more efficiently. This new model of water heater will only run when you use it. There is no need for a tank to heat, cool, or fill, which makes it easier to save energy and money.
